Output 95953d18120d7d64cbba1b1a17c06f38578ce62787fdfd87e7c23aee55e7a897:9

value
310260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d93e6fb9c454e328205cbc79d8e31425609716 OP_EQUAL
address
3QCEQ7174PEF6NVUdnqi4sRb3dvp8SpWFh
transaction
95953d18120d7d64cbba1b1a17c06f38578ce62787fdfd87e7c23aee55e7a897
spent
true